Chaired by Sir Robert Buckland QC MP, the Levelling Up Commission held its first inquiry session on the role of system change and devolution in the Levelling Up agenda. The panel of experts discussed the merits of doing so, and how 'London-style powers' can benefit other local authorities in service delivery . Panellists: Ben Houchen, Mayor of Teesside Sir Merrick Cockell, Chair Localis and former Chair Local Government Association Cllr Richard Clewer, Leader Wiltshire Unitary Council Cllr Sam Chapman-Allen, Chair District Councils’ Network Cllr Tim Oliver, Leader Surrey County Council and Chair, County Councils Network Tim Bowles, former Mayor of West of England and Chair of the M9 Group of Mayors Ian Hudspeth OBE, former Leader of Oxfordshire County Council Cllr Euan Jardine, Conservative Group Leader Scottish Borders Council Cllr Susan Hall AM, Leader Greater London Assembly Conservatives Professor Tony Travers, Visiting Professor in Department of Government, LSE About the Commission: Chaired by former Secretary of State, Sir Robert Buckland QC MP and a committee of local and regional government leaders, the Commission intends to consider ways to implement the Government’s Levelling Up White Paper and subsequent Bill from the perspective of local and regional government. Too often the Levelling Up agenda is something being done ‘to and for’ local and regional government, the Commission intends to make sure it is done ‘with and by’ them. Through roundtable meetings with MPs and senior leaders of local and regional government from across the UK, the Commission intends to set out a series of recommendations to deliver the 12 national ‘Missions’ through system change, boosting pay and productivity, spreading opportunities, improving public services and restoring local pride. #politics #policy #government #levellingup #conservative
